The job market in Buffalo, New York

With data compiled from reliable public sources and government organizations like the Bureau of Labor Statistics and the U.S. Census Bureau, Joblift provides you with essential insights to help you in your job search in Buffalo, NY.

In Buffalo, the primary industries driving economic growth are financial services, technology, and education. These sectors contribute significantly to the city's thriving job market and offer diverse opportunities for job seekers. With a strong focus on innovation and development, Buffalo is well-positioned to attract top talent in these fields. The city provides an ideal environment for professionals seeking new challenges while maintaining a high quality of life. Overall, Buffalo's industry landscape presents promising prospects for individuals looking to advance their careers.

In the city, an individual seeking employment can expect a 20-minute average commute to their workplace. Approximately 37% of employed persons receive insurance coverage through their employer in this locale. With a cost of living index that is 12% lower than the national average, residents can enjoy a more affordable lifestyle. However, it is important to note that the average salary is $57,633, which is about 16.75% below the national average. Despite this, the city offers a range of opportunities for jobseekers in various industries and sectors.

The economy of Buffalo, NY currently experiences an unemployment rate of 9.50%, which is above the national average of 3.8%. Despite this higher rate, the city anticipates steady future job market growth in its local economy. As a result, the prospects for employment opportunities in Buffalo continue to show promise, fostering optimism among those seeking jobs in this region.
